Stanford asks an electrical master’s student to define depth before choosing breadth. Twelve quarter units come from one approved technical area, and another nine come from outside it. A course listed in the chosen depth area cannot be reused as breadth. That rule gives a prospective student a concrete way to test a plan that combines circuits, devices, communications or computation.

Graduate engineering tuition is $15,100 per quarter at 8–10 units or $23,239 at 11–18 units. These are current enrollment-band rates, not a fixed whole-degree price. Fees, insurance, living expenses and future-year tuition changes are additional.

MS course and research assistantships are limited, with priority given to PhD students. Departmental grants, scholarships and fellowships do not fund the MS, while separate external or university-wide awards may be available. A 50% qualifying assistantship includes the stated tuition allowance, salary and insurance subsidy; an appointment is not guaranteed.

Stanford's electrical MS uses a defined depth-and-breadth structure within a largely individualized course plan. You'll complete twelve quarter units in one depth area, nine units outside that area, fifteen technical units and nine additional approved units. The five depth areas range from circuits and physical technology to communications, software/hardware systems, and signal processing with control and optimization. The standard degree is based on coursework and does not require a thesis. That makes it a strong program to examine when your goal is advanced technical practice and you already know which graduate courses support it.

What you’ll study

  • The degree requires 45 quarter units:12 depth units, nine breadth units,15 technical units and nine additional approved units.
  • Depth courses must be at the 200 level or above, with at least six units at the 300 level or above. Breadth courses must come from outside the selected depth area.
  • The technical requirement includes at least nine units of 200-level or higher lecture courses. A program proposal is due by the end of the first quarter for regular full-time entrants.

Areas of focus

  • Circuits
  • Software and Hardware Systems
  • Communications and Networking
  • Physical Technology and Science
  • Signal Processing, Control and Optimization

Admission & progression

  • Applicants with electrical engineering, other engineering, mathematics, physics or related-science backgrounds are welcome. Adequate preparation in circuits, digital systems, laboratories, mathematics and physics is important.
  • The external full-time MS admits for autumn entry. The published deadline for autumn 2027 is December 1,2026.
  • Transfer applicants follow the regular admission process. Coursework from another institution cannot be transferred into the Stanford MS.

Research & project requirements

  • The standard MS has no thesis requirement. An approved plan can include independent study within the applicable limits.
  • The optional distinction-in-research route adds a substantial supervised research commitment and an approved research report. It is separate from the standard coursework requirements.
  • A faculty program advisor helps students plan courses and explore academic opportunities.

Building a Stanford electrical MS depth-and-breadth plan

The Stanford bulletin identifies five depth areas: circuits; software and hardware systems; communications and networking; physical technology and science; and signal processing, control and optimization. All depth courses must be at the 200 level or above, with at least six units at the 300 level or above. The choice is therefore more specific than choosing a broad interest such as electronics and then collecting any available graduate electives.

The technical requirement adds fifteen units, including at least nine units of graduate-level lecture courses. Independent study cannot replace that required lecture block. Another nine units complete the standard program, subject to the approved course rules. Before applying, draft a tentative depth area and a few breadth courses, then check their prerequisites. The faculty program advisor helps finalize the plan after admission, and regular full-time entrants submit their proposal by the end of the first quarter.

Stanford’s terminal MS and optional research distinction

The standard degree has no thesis requirement, and admission to it does not provide automatic entry to the electrical PhD. A student who later wants the doctorate applies through the annual doctoral admission process. Stanford also advises applicants whose clear ultimate goal is a PhD to consider applying directly to that degree. That distinction matters when comparing electrical engineering master’s programs in California for research preparation rather than immediate advanced professional study.

A separate distinction-in-research option adds a substantial supervised research commitment and an approved research report to the regular MS requirements. It should be considered with the faculty supervision and time it needs. Don't treat the existence of an optional research route as a promise that every course-based master’s student will receive a funded laboratory position. What Stanford’s quarter tuition means for a master’s budget

For 2026–27, graduate engineering tuition is $15,100 per quarter at eight to ten units and $23,239 at eleven to eighteen units. Stanford describes one-and-a-half to two years as the usual full-time completion period. A forty-five-unit degree should not be priced by multiplying a single per-credit amount across all units, because the tuition schedule uses enrollment bands and future-year rates can change. Add fees, insurance and the living costs for the quarters you expect to attend.

MS departmental assistantships are limited, with priority for PhD students. The department’s course-assistant process also has prior-enrollment and academic conditions. Prepare an initial budget from confirmed resources, then include an assistantship only when you have a specific offer. Can a Stanford depth course count again as breadth?

A course in the selected depth area cannot be used to fulfill the breadth requirement. The program requires separate depth and breadth units, along with technical and other approved coursework.

Does Stanford’s electrical MS require a thesis?

The standard degree does not require a thesis. An optional distinction-in-research route has additional supervised research and report requirements. Admission to the MS is separate from doctoral admission.

Can graduate coursework from another university transfer into Stanford’s MS?

Stanford’s MS admission FAQ states that credits from another institution cannot transfer into the degree. Applicants from other universities follow the same admission procedure as new applicants.
